NAME: Blowhard, #3047

LENGTH:
2.0 Miles

DIFFICULTY:
Moderate

HIKING TIME:
2 Hours

TRAILHEAD LOCATION:

From Cedar City travel east U- 14 to junction of State Road # 148, (Cedar Breaks Road). Follow #148 north 1.5 miles to FR #277, (Blowhard Station Road). Follow the road to powerline radar stations. Follow powerline west to trailhead. Trailhead is at 10,620 feet.

DESCRIPTION:

The trail follows powerline west, to a rim overlooking a beautiful view of Cedar Canyon The trail follows powerline and ridge spine through a mixed conifer stand, then drops sharply eventually entering a stand of Bristlecone Pine and a red ridge looking into Cedar Breaks and Ashdown Wilderness Area. View includes a spectacular look at red rock of the Wasatch Formation. The Bristlecone Forest offers a unique sight of grotesque shapes formed by these ancient trees. The trail continues downhill and under powerline on Ashdown Gorge Wilderness Boundary to rim of Ashdown Gorge. Trail follows close to the rim edge and offers many beautiful sites. Trail continues downhill through mature stands of spruce, fir, ponderosa and eventually into aspen before it ends at the junction of Potato Hollow, Trail #050, in Long Hollow.

PERTINENT USGS MAP(S):
Webster Flat, Navajo Lake
